East Hants crash claims life of 55-year old man
Posted 13 October 2023

East Hants crash claims life of 55-year old man

A 55-year old man is dead after a single-vehicle crash in East Hants. It happened before 6 a.m. yesterday on Highway 215 in Noel (NOLE) Shore. He was driving a pickup truck when it left the road and ended up in the ditch. The investigation is ongoing.
